四川省大豆种质资源表型性状鉴定及综合评价

Phenotypic Identification and Evaluation of Soybean Germplasm Resources in Sichuan Province

摘要

Abstract

In order to effectively utilize soybean germplasm resources in Sichuan Province in China.216 soybean germplasm were collected.In this research,12 phenotypic characters of this soybean germplasm resources in Sichuan Province were identified and comprehensively evaluated by correlation analysis,principal component analysis and clustering analysis.Our results showed that the genotypes of soybean collected in Sichuan were rich in genetic diversity.The diversity index of 9 quality traitsrangingfrom0.043 to1.596,whichwas the highest in seed color(1.596)and the lowest in cotyledon color(0.043).3 quantitativetraitsrangingfrom2.581 to2.812,which was the highest in100-seed weight(2.812).Principal component analysis showed that the cumulative contribution rate of the six principal component factors was 72.85%.The comprehensive evaluation D value ranging from 0.002 to 0.278.216 soybean germplasm could be classified into 4 categories by cluster analysis,Cluster Ⅰ showed the best performance in 100-seed weight(31 germplasms).The plant height of cluster Ⅱ was the highest(52 germplasms).Cluster Ⅲ showed the shortest growth period(57 germplasms).The 100-seed weight and plant height of cluster Ⅳ was low(76 germplasms).This study can provide a new reference for the utilization of soybean germplasm and breeding.
